dc.descriptionIn this poetry submission, titled "Trust In All That Is Good," Participant 354 writes about their quarantine experience, describing their daily activities while confined to their home during the COVID-19 pandemic. The participant gives viewers tips on how to remain disciplined and motivated wilst staying at home. The participant also provides resources for those that need help optimizing their mental health.
